Output 94a813ec24a4c7a16174c7855a2062867cc2dda99a7aba4d187b12f643797295:21

value
27861197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f742c2aa624591634b7728260337383383abe3c OP_EQUAL
address
MSp5GwvG9JeU3qegpqyx5otiS8KvPPP1Xa
transaction
94a813ec24a4c7a16174c7855a2062867cc2dda99a7aba4d187b12f643797295
spent
true